GROUND SHORTING PORTION DETECTING DEVICE, GROUND SHORTING PORTION DETECTING METHOD, AND GROUND SHORTING PORTION DETECTING PROGRAM

PROBLEM TO BE SOLVED: To identify a location where a ground short occurs with a simple configuration.SOLUTION: A CPU 1 and a plurality of slave devices 2 to 5 are connected to each other. Cutoff SWs 6 to 9 are respectively inserted and connected between the slave devices 2 to 5 and the CPU 1. Then, on-off control is performed on each of the cutoff SWs 6 to 9 with a logic determined on the basis of the presence or absence of occurrence of a ground short of the slave devices 2 to 5 at the preceding stage. As a result, when the CPU 1 merely outputs a SW control signal for the cutoff SW 6 of the first stage, the on-off control of the cutoff switches 7 to 9 at the subsequent stage is performed on the basis of the presence or absence of occurrence of a ground short. The on-off state of each of the cutoff SWs 6 to 9 and the slave devices 2 to 5 capable of normally performing communication change according to the occurrence place of the ground short. Therefore, when the on-off state of each of the cutoff SWs 6 to 9 and the slave devices 2 to 5 capable of normally performing communication are detected, it is possible to specify the occurrence place of the ground short.SELECTED DRAWING: Figure 1
